5898396 Rolleston Church - North Doorway: sepia drawing, 1848 (drawing) by Buckler, John (1770-1851); 20.3x22.9 cm; (add.info.: North Doorway of Rolleston Church, Staffordshire, showing a Norman arch of two orders on pillars (the outer arch is wavy.) Also showing a carved face on the key stone.); eWilliam Salt Library; English, out of copyright

This sepia drawing from 1848 transports us back in time to the enchanting Rolleston Church in Staffordshire. The artist, John Buckler, skillfully captures the essence of this historical masterpiece through his meticulous attention to detail. The focal point of the image is undoubtedly the North Doorway, which showcases a magnificent Norman arch consisting of two orders on pillars. What makes this arch truly unique is its outer waviness, adding an intriguing twist to its architectural beauty. As our eyes wander further into the drawing, we are drawn to a meticulously carved face on the key stone, exuding an air of mystery and intrigue.
